Charitable objects
(A) TO RELIEVE OR ASSIST IN THE ALLEVIATION OF MENTAL SUFFERING, SICKNESS OR DISTRESS AMONGST MEMBERS OF THE PUBLIC RESULTING FROM THEIR MEMBERSHIP, AFFILIATION OR RELATIONSHIP, WITH ANY ORGANISATION OR GROUPS, WHETHER OR NOT ESTABLISHED WITHIN THE UNITED KINGDOM OR ELSEWHERE. (B) TO ASSIST AND COUNSEL THE FAMILIES OR FRIENDS OF ANY SUCH PERSONS WHO MAY THEMSELVES BE IN NEED, HARDSHIP OR DISTRESS AS A CONSEQUENCE OF THE ABOVE.
